nelson posted:Well, subversion dumps lots of local meta data files all over the place. When you're copying a directory from a different server to your local directory (this was a porting type project, had to get the latest code from the other developers who were on a separate repository before checking it into my repository), you end up copying all those meta data files too. Unfortunately, it really confuses the hell out of subversion when you do that. The next major release of Subversion (1.7) is going to offer a working copy scheme like git where all the metadata is in one hidden directory at the root of the WC. The multiple ".svn" directories is my biggest peeve with Subversion. Thankfully, that's going away. BTW, the most important tip for new users to SVN is to use: svn add --force . instead of svn add * when you want to make sure you've recursively added everything in your working copy directories, but don't want to accidentally include ignored files. This is especially true for Windows SVN users who have no clue about globbing.

beuges posted:This is probably straightforward, but is it possible to create a new repository, and import a project from an existing repository, along with all of its revision history? You can do this pretty easily with git. First, import all of your repository's history into a temporary git repository (plenty of online tutorials for this). Then do `git rev-list --reverse client1` to get a list of all the commits that touch the client1 directory. Then init a new repository for client1 and cherry-pick those patches in from your temporary svn-import repo. Something like this, for each client, after importing to git from svn: pre:tmp-svn-import$ git rev-list --reverse client1 > ~/client1_commits tmp-svn-import$ mkdir ~/client1 && cd ~/client1 client1$ git init client1$ git remote add tmp-svn ~/tmp-svn-import client1$ git fetch tmp-svn client1$ git cherry-pick <commit from ~/client1_commits> # write a script do this

beuges posted:My tree looks like so: First, you need to dump the repository using "svnadmin dump" and then create new dumpfiles of each part of the repository using svndumpfilter. You can then create new repositories and use those filtered dumpfiles to fill it in with just those pieces. Be careful you don't filter out directories that are copies.

beuges posted:Thanks! Speaking of copies, something that just occurred to me is that I have a bunch of code common to all clients. Obviously using the layout I've described would mean a separate "common" repository. Is there a way to link a project in one repository to a project in another? So as far as client1 is concerned, his tree has project1, project2 and common, but common is actually residing in shared/common instead? Meaning that when i update client2/common for whatever reason, that change also reflects in client1/common? There is a way to do that where you include files from another repository, but it's more trouble than it's worth. I'd restructure it so that your "common" directory is a separate repository that's at the same level as the client's code. In other words, structure it so it's two repositories next to each other instead of a repository inside another repository's tree. Don't forget that you can check out a working copy as deep into the repository as you like.

Sizzlechest posted:He's looking to set up a repository at work. He didn't explicitly say it, but I'm going to go out on a limb and guess the following are true: These are all bullshit reasons. 1. You can do fine-grained access control in a distributed system: your central repo server would enforce these rules. 2. You don't lose control over the source code just because you're using a distributed system any more than with a centralized system. 3. Even if you have a great network, having most commands run instantly is still a plus. It's even more useful if you're telecommuting or you have multiple locations. 4. Branching doesn't just mean making a "flavor" of a codebase: you branch when you want to implement a large feature without loving up the current main code base, you branch when you need to maintain old maintenance branches. 5. If you're branching in svn, you're gonna have to do merges no matter what. With Git or Mercurial it's most likely going to be a lot easier. They're just better at branching. If all your devs are using one svn repo, well, then you're all gonna be doing a tons of mini-merges with each svn up, which is annoying as gently caress. The only real reason not to use Git or Mercurial is if you need to version large binaries. Where I work we migrated from Subversion to Mercurial, and it's been great.

Sizzlechest posted:He's looking to set up a repository at work. He didn't explicitly say it, but I'm going to go out on a limb and guess the following are true: A distributed setup does not, in itself, increase the odds of larger merge conflicts. Merging as late as possible increases these odds. What kind of VCS do you think encourages people to delay merging as long as they can? One where repeated merging is painful (and destroys history), or one in which merging is clean, easy and fast? When I have a long-running topic branch, I regularly merge the master branch into it and fix any merge conflicts as they arise. Then, when I merge in the other direction, it's trivial. (Note that this is equivalent to keeping unstable changes in your SVN working copy and repeatedly 'svn up'ing whenever anyone else commits.) It's absurd to suggest that a DVCS would inspire employees to fork the codebase and never contribute their changes back to the mainline. I do, however, have the right to say "I want to work in private" -- I get to incrementally commit and refine my changes until they're ready to share with others. My experimental branches don't clutter up everyone else's history unless I decide to push them to the central repository, but I can share them if I want to. I'll go so far as to say that starting from scratch with Subversion is stupid. Even for two people, a distributed system (and the branching capabilities that it comes with) is superior in every way.
